Product Overview:

Medline's Generation 4 Basic 4-Wheeled Walking Knee Scooter delivers safety and support, and also lowers the risk of falls. Also known as the Medline Generation 4 Basic 4-Wheeled Knee Walker, this updated design highlights four wheels to optimize stability, turning, and maneuverability, along with height-adjustability to ensure the perfect fit for every user. This smooth-rolling support offers a great alternative to crutches, eliminating the arm and hand strains often associated with crutch use and improving secure mobility. Accommodating a 300-pound weight capacity and highlighting dual handbrakes to maximize stopping control, this dependable knee walker is often used in physical therapy and rehab clinics, hospitals, and other care facilities. It's also used by individuals in their homes.

If you're recovering from an ankle, foot, or lower-leg injury, the Generation 4 Basic 4-Wheeled Walking Knee Scooter gives you greater stability, comfort, and mobility while you heal. Specially developed as a safer, more secure, and comfortable alternative to crutches, this scooter boasts a sleek new frame and (4) wheels to optimize stability and maneuverability. Taking the strain off the underarms and hands that crutches typically cause, this smooth-rolling knee scooter comes with a cushioned pad that enables you to take the weight off your affected leg as you safely propel your way forward with your other foot.

Often used by hospitals, rehab and therapy clinics, and other care facilities, this knee scooter promotes healing, keeping the affected leg from strains, bumps, and other injuries by off-loading it onto the cushioned knee pad. It facilitates mobility for users recovering from a wide range of foot, ankle, and lower leg issues, including diabetic wounds, pressure injuries, fractures, sprains, and strains. Aiding in preventing the falls that can happen with crutches, its adjustable height ensures a perfect fit for a variety of patients; it provides versatile support for both the left or right leg. Dual handbrakes facilitate superior stopping control, while the scooter's durable aluminum frame delivers secure support for users weighing up to 300-pounds. Best of all, this scooter comes with a convenient storage basket affixed to its front, allowing you to keep your belongings in close accessibility.
